Diego Barrera is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Polymers and Plastics. According to data from OpenAlex, Diego Barrera has authored 23 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Materials Chemistry, 13 papers in Electrical and Electronic Engineering and 5 papers in Polymers and Plastics. Recurrent topics in Diego Barrera’s work include Perovskite Materials and Applications (7 papers), Quantum Dots Synthesis And Properties (6 papers) and 2D Materials and Applications (5 papers). Diego Barrera is often cited by papers focused on Perovskite Materials and Applications (7 papers), Quantum Dots Synthesis And Properties (6 papers) and 2D Materials and Applications (5 papers). Diego Barrera collaborates with scholars based in United States, Mexico and South Korea. Diego Barrera's co-authors include Julia W. P. Hsu, Jian Wang, Rafik Addou, Robert M. Wallace, Harvey W. Yarranton, Manuel Quevedo-López, Luigi Colombo, Hui Zhu, Christopher L. Hinkle and Zaibing Guo and has published in prestigious journals such as ACS Nano, Journal of Applied Physics and The Journal of Physical Chemistry C.
